As investigators questioned Tracey Krueger about Kerry O'Brien Krueger's disappearance, details of his story kept changing. The destination, transportation, who called Kerry, and even when she was supposed to return varied depending on the account.

But one detail stood out: Tracey's own father told police that Tracey mentioned Kerry's trip on December 4, a full day before Kerry supposedly received the call sending her there.
